This case report describes an 8-week-old premature infant with a massive extravasation injury of the right forearm and hand managed with acellular dermal matrix (Pelnac®) followed by Meek micrografting, achieving a 93% engraftment rate.
This case report describes the management of an extensive extravasation injury in an 8-week-old premature infant involving the right forearm and dorsum of the hand. The multidisciplinary team performed debridement of necrotic tissue, temporary wound coverage with Pelnac® acellular dermal matrix, and definitive coverage using Meek micrografting three weeks later. Out of 226 micrografts transplanted, 210 survived, yielding an engraftment rate of 93%. The Vancouver Scar Scale score was 6, indicating moderate scarring. At 1-year follow-up, goniometric measurements demonstrated improved passive elbow flexion from 130 to 140 degrees and extension from 50 to 80 degrees, as well as improved wrist passive flexion from 25 to 60 degrees and extension from 30 to 50 degrees. The first finger range of motion did not improve due to severe extensor tendon damage.
